Vercel-AI-SDK-specific attack surface
useChatendpoints are typically POSTs to/api/chatwith{ messages: CoreMessage[] }. They're often public — auth left as "TODO".streamText({ tools: { x: tool({ execute }) } })runsexecutewith the model's chosen args. The SDK enforces the zod schema, butz.string()is a wide-open hole if not narrowed (z.enum, regex).experimental_attachments(image/files passed byuseChat) are forwarded to the model unless the route handler validates size/MIME.- Output rendering: many demos pipe
streamTextoutput into<ReactMarkdown>with HTML enabled, or directly intodangerouslySetInnerHTML. Prompt-injected markdown becomes XSS. onFinishcallback often pipes content to remote telemetry — leakage vector.

Wrong vs. right
VAI-TOOL-001 (loose tool schema)
// ❌
const tools = {
run: tool({
description: "Run a command",
parameters: z.object({ cmd: z.string() }), // z.string() = anything
execute: async ({ cmd }) => execAsync(cmd),
}),
};
// ✅
const tools = {
run: tool({
description: "Run an allowlisted task",
parameters: z.object({
task: z.enum(["build", "test", "lint"]),
}).strict(),
execute: async ({ task }) => runAllowlisted(task),
}),
};
VAI-AUTH-001 (no auth on /api/chat)
// ❌
export async function POST(req: Request) {
const { messages } = await req.json();
return streamText({ model, messages, tools }).toDataStreamResponse();
}
// ✅
export async function POST(req: Request) {
const session = await auth();
if (!session?.user) return new Response("Unauthorized", { status: 401 });
const { success } = await ratelimit.limit(session.user.id);
if (!success) return new Response("Too Many Requests", { status: 429 });
const { messages } = await req.json();
// Drop client-supplied system messages; pin server-side
const sanitized = messages.filter((m: { role: string }) => m.role !== "system");
return streamText({
model, system: SYSTEM_PROMPT, messages: sanitized, tools,
}).toDataStreamResponse();
}
VAI-OUT-001 (markdown XSS via injection)
// ❌
<ReactMarkdown rehypePlugins={[rehypeRaw]}>{message.content}</ReactMarkdown>
// ✅
<ReactMarkdown
remarkPlugins={[remarkGfm]}
rehypePlugins={[rehypeSanitize]}
components={{
a: ({ href, children }) => {
if (href && /^javascript:/i.test(href)) return <span>{children}</span>;
return <a href={href} rel="noopener noreferrer" target="_blank">{children}</a>;
},
}}
>
{message.content}
</ReactMarkdown>
